文章
Cursor+Claude重构支付模块:40小时缩至11小时
Reading Path / ARTICLE
先抓主张,再转成行动
#377 · 21ZHAO Blog · 读完进入产品或下一篇
阅读数据加载中…
点赞数据加载中…
承上启下:在上一篇《Cursor 老用户遭遇高频超时与额度争议》中,我们探讨了 Cursor 服务在高上下文负荷下的超时表现与老用户的信任危机。本篇则将转向正面的实战维度,深入探讨在克服这些工具摩擦的同时,如何通过 Cursor 与 Claude Code 的巧妙组合,在真实业务场景中大幅缩短支付模块的重构时间。
在遗留代码重构的深水区,时间成本与代码质量往往是一对矛盾。近期有开发者分享了一次利用 AI 编程工具组合重构支付模块的真实案例:将原本预估需要 40 小时的工作量,压缩至 11 小时完成,且最终代码质量反而更高。这并非简单的工具评测,而是一份来自真实战场的操作手册,揭示了 AI 辅助编程在复杂业务场景下的落地潜力。
关键信息
此次重构的核心在于工具链的协同与策略的执行,主要包含以下五个关键技巧:
- 工具组合策略:结合 Cursor 的上下文感知能力与 Claude Code 的逻辑推理优势,形成互补。
- 模块化拆解:将庞大的支付模块拆解为可独立验证的小单元,降低 AI 理解偏差。
- 测试先行:在重构前建立完善的测试用例,确保 AI 生成的代码符合预期行为。
- 迭代式审查:不一次性生成全部代码,而是分步生成、分步审查,及时修正逻辑漏洞。
- 文档辅助:利用 AI 生成或更新模块文档,帮助后续维护者快速理解重构后的架构。
为什么值得关注
- 效率量级提升:从 40 小时到 11 小时,效率提升近 4 倍,展示了 AI 在处理重复性高、逻辑复杂的遗留代码时的巨大潜力。
- 质量反直觉提升:通常认为快速重构可能牺牲质量,但案例显示,在正确策略下,AI 辅助重构能产出更规范、更易维护的代码。
- 实战参考价值:不同于理论探讨,该案例提供了具体可操作的五步法,对面临类似技术债的团队具有直接借鉴意义。
可延展观察
- AI 编程工具的边界:哪些类型的遗留代码最适合 AI 重构?哪些场景仍需谨慎人工介入?
- 团队协作模式变化:当 AI 承担大量基础重构工作,开发者的角色将如何从“编码者”转向“架构师”与“审查者”?
- 长期维护成本:AI 重构后的代码在长期维护中是否真的更稳定?是否有数据支持这一结论?
参考来源
💡 下一篇预告:借助 AI 代码生成不仅能为核心业务模块重构降本增效,在分布式与微服务架构的标准化构建中,研发效率的变革同样在发生。在下一篇《Kratos新范式:一套Schema生成全量代码》中,我们将探寻 Go-Kratos 微服务生态下的接口定义与自动化代码生成实践。